Staying Active: Simple Outdoor Exercises for Seniors


Introduction

Getting outdoors is not only beneficial for physical health but also for mental well-being. Fresh air and natural light can do wonders for a senior's mood and energy levels.

The Benefits of Outdoor Exercise

Exercising outside has benefits beyond the physical. It enhances mood, reduces stress, and offers opportunities for social engagement, all of which are vital for mental wellness among seniors.

Walking: The Perfect Outdoor Activity

One of the simplest yet most effective exercises is walking. It’s low-impact, requires no special equipment, and can be done anywhere. Aim for at least 30 minutes a day.

Gardening: A Fun Way to Stay Fit

Gardening is not only enjoyable but also provides a full-body workout. It improves flexibility and strength while allowing seniors to connect with nature.

Group Activities: Finding Community

Joining group activities like yoga in the park or walking clubs can enhance motivation and make exercising more enjoyable. Social connections can significantly impact overall health.

Safety Tips for Outdoor Exercise

Always consider the weather and wear appropriate clothing. Additionally, seniors should stay hydrated and avoid exercising during extreme temperatures.
